This book focuses on the alternative therapeutic approach for managing Parkinsons disease.

This manuscript analyses the curative properties of natural ingredients and bioactive compounds known as nutraceuticals from natural foods, herbs, spices and plant extracts.

Scientific revelations supported by conducted research concerning these remedies are presented.

For example, consuming foods from natural sources that are rich in amino acids, antioxidants, vitamins and alkaloids may reduce the chances of onset of Parkinsons disease, and suggests that nutrition and diet have an impact on disease management.

In addition, epigenetic modifications in conjunction with Parkinsons disease are also discussed in this book.
